blackfin 28 4 мая, 2020 Опубликовано 4 мая, 2020 · Жалоба 6 minutes ago, GenaSPB said: Последний месяц м2чения состояли только в том чтобы найти где смонтируют. И эта уже четвёртая в ряду попыток, с разнообразными дефектами пайки в предыдущие разя. Тут все работает как предсказанио, т.е. нормально. Вы двух строчек без ошибок на клавиатуре набрать не можете, а хотите, чтобы вам спаяли без дефектов.. Смешно.. :) Цитата Поделиться сообщением Ссылка на сообщение Поделиться на другие сайты Поделиться
mantech 53 4 мая, 2020 Опубликовано 4 мая, 2020 · Жалоба 5 часов назад, GenaSPB сказал: Разумеется долго, никому не надо - все за свои деньги. Раз хобби, то конечно надо только себе, у меня похожее дело было когда-то. Цитата Поделиться сообщением Ссылка на сообщение Поделиться на другие сайты Поделиться
GenaSPB 11 4 мая, 2020 Опубликовано 4 мая, 2020 · Жалоба 2 hours ago, blackfin said: Вы двух строчек без ошибок на клавиатуре набрать не можете, а хотите, чтобы вам спаяли без дефектов.. Смешно.. :) Да мимо экранной клавиатуры попадаю... граммар наци? Цитата Поделиться сообщением Ссылка на сообщение Поделиться на другие сайты Поделиться
skripach 6 4 мая, 2020 Опубликовано 4 мая, 2020 · Жалоба 11 hours ago, GenaSPB said: Короче, плата запустилась, DDR3 работает на 533. От входного 3.3 плата потребляет 250 мА (работает одно A7 ядро на 800 МГц, память, USB HS DEVICE и LTDC). Трассировка удручает. :) Цитата Поделиться сообщением Ссылка на сообщение Поделиться на другие сайты Поделиться
GenaSPB 11 4 мая, 2020 Опубликовано 4 мая, 2020 · Жалоба Зато работает... чуть подвигаю потом компоненты, только сейчас петли заметил (когда провод сам через себя проходит). Цитата Поделиться сообщением Ссылка на сообщение Поделиться на другие сайты Поделиться
Obam 38 5 мая, 2020 Опубликовано 5 мая, 2020 · Жалоба Чёрную, а ещё лучше белую, маску надо было - про трассировку никто и не заикнулся бы. Цитата Поделиться сообщением Ссылка на сообщение Поделиться на другие сайты Поделиться
GenaSPB 11 5 мая, 2020 Опубликовано 5 мая, 2020 · Жалоба Я же проект выложил.. не поможет. Цитата Поделиться сообщением Ссылка на сообщение Поделиться на другие сайты Поделиться
Obam 38 5 мая, 2020 Опубликовано 5 мая, 2020 · Жалоба Фотку больше народа увидело... о, идея (может на будущее): выложить проект с расставленными компонентами и пусть "айвазовские-репины-рафаэли" поучаствуют ;-) Цитата Поделиться сообщением Ссылка на сообщение Поделиться на другие сайты Поделиться
GenaSPB 11 5 мая, 2020 Опубликовано 5 мая, 2020 (изменено) · Жалоба Предлагал... один коллега даже взялся - но настроение коронавирус ему подточил. А двигать тут можно все кроме разъемов и размеры платы желательно не раздвигать. Надо посмотреть в потреблении что сколько берет - что ухолит на 3.3 вольт IO, а что на вход DC-DC 1.2 и 1.35 В аттачменте - тестовая прошивка для флешки этой платы. На UART2 (PD5) 115.2k 8-N-1 выдае много всякй диагностики что может - про память например... Запускает процессор на 650 МГц от внутреннего RC генератора, USB OTH на 2-м выделенном порту представляется как HS устройство. Пользуясь DFU можно прошивать флешку и запускать на выполнение бинарники не прошивая их. В принципе могло бы работать на любом процессоре, но некоторые выходы программирует на вывод (чипселекты будущего применения), SPI... boot.hex Изменено 6 мая, 2020 пользователем GenaSPB Добавлна тестовая прошивка Цитата Поделиться сообщением Ссылка на сообщение Поделиться на другие сайты Поделиться
repstosw 18 7 мая, 2020 Опубликовано 7 мая, 2020 · Жалоба On 5/4/2020 at 8:09 PM, GenaSPB said: Короче, плата запустилась, DDR3 работает на 533. От входного 3.3 плата потребляет 250 мА (работает одно A7 ядро на 800 МГц, память, USB HS DEVICE и LTDC) GenaSPB, отличное начало! Респект! Тоже планирую переходить на DDR и на корпуса BGA :) Цитата Поделиться сообщением Ссылка на сообщение Поделиться на другие сайты Поделиться
GenaSPB 11 12 июня, 2020 Опубликовано 12 июня, 2020 · Жалоба Проблема. Есть SAI + DMA в режиме double buffer. BURST не используется. Буферу делается Invalidate после окончания обмена в буфере не все данные соответствуют принятым (старое содержимое остается). Вставил в обработчик прерывания Terminal Count команду __DMB() перед использованием данных - стало лучше (но не на 100%). ПРавильно ли я выбрал способ ожидания окончания обмена по внутренним шинам? Цитата Поделиться сообщением Ссылка на сообщение Поделиться на другие сайты Поделиться
GenaSPB 11 12 июня, 2020 Опубликовано 12 июня, 2020 · Жалоба ARM пишет что для того и предназначено. Цитата Поделиться сообщением Ссылка на сообщение Поделиться на другие сайты Поделиться
GenaSPB 11 14 июня, 2020 Опубликовано 14 июня, 2020 (изменено) · Жалоба Продолжаю бороться с той же проблемой. Полное ощущение, что вызовы L1C_InvalidateDCacheMVA (который далее пишет в DCIMVAC) для части строк кеша не отрабатывают. И начальный адрес области буфера и инвалидируемый размер - всё выровнено на 64 (пробовал и 32) байта - размер строки DCACHE этого процессора. Выглядит как то, что часть области памяти в которую принимает DMA с SAI данные сохранила старое содержимое. Или у процессора есть L2 cache (а он есть!) до которого clean не доходит... Вопрос - как сделать такой invalidate чтобы он и на unified cache действовал. Вот так оно уже работает... USB больше не висит на самолуде... Изменено 14 июня, 2020 пользователем GenaSPB Цитата Поделиться сообщением Ссылка на сообщение Поделиться на другие сайты Поделиться
mantech 53 15 июня, 2020 Опубликовано 15 июня, 2020 · Жалоба 11 часов назад, GenaSPB сказал: Вот так оно уже работает... Что это за агрегат такой? Цитата Поделиться сообщением Ссылка на сообщение Поделиться на другие сайты Поделиться
GenaSPB 11 15 июня, 2020 Опубликовано 15 июня, 2020 (изменено) · Жалоба SDR радио приёмопередающее, коротковолновое, радиолюбительское. Хотя хор зрителей советует "поставь малину и не парься". Изменено 15 июня, 2020 пользователем GenaSPB Цитата Поделиться сообщением Ссылка на сообщение Поделиться на другие сайты Поделиться